TOPIC: ARE YOU SELECTIVE OR INCLUSIVE IN SHARING GOD'S LOVE? First Reading: Romans 11: 29-36 Responsorial Psalm: Psalms 69: 30-31, 33-34, 36 Alleluia: John 8: 31b-32 Gospel: Luke 14: 12-14 In the Concluding Mass of the recent Synod, Pope Francis said that the whole point of the Synod is to strengthen the Church's missionary outreach, with loving God with our whole life, and our neighbors as ourselves as the heart of everything. Following the Holy Father's lead, we are called to imitate Jesus, whose love knows no bounds and not limited for a select few.
